kvm虚拟化命令,KVM虚拟机命令之mount详解与操作指南
- 综合资讯
- 2024-11-07 13:43:00
- 2

KVM虚拟化命令中,mount命令用于挂载文件系统。本文详细介绍了mount命令的用法和操作指南,包括挂载点、挂载选项和常用命令,帮助用户轻松掌握KVM虚拟机文件系统挂...
KVM虚拟化命令中,mount命令用于挂载文件系统。本文详细介绍了mount命令的用法和操作指南,包括挂载点、挂载选项和常用命令,帮助用户轻松掌握KVM虚拟机文件系统挂载技巧。
KVM(Kernel-based Virtual Machine)是基于Linux内核的虚拟化技术,它允许在一台物理机上运行多个虚拟机,在KVM虚拟机中,我们可以使用mount命令来挂载各种文件系统,以便对文件进行访问和管理,本文将详细介绍KVM虚拟机命令mount的用法、参数及其在实际操作中的应用。
mount命令概述
mount命令用于在Linux系统中挂载文件系统,使得文件系统能够被用户和程序访问,在KVM虚拟机中,mount命令同样适用,用于挂载虚拟机的文件系统,以下是mount命令的基本语法:
mount [-t 文件系统类型] [-o 挂载选项] 源设备 目标挂载点
文件系统类型
表示要挂载的文件系统的类型,如ext4、ext3、ext2、vfat等;挂载选项
用于指定挂载时的特殊选项,如ro、rw、bind等;源设备
表示要挂载的设备,如物理硬盘、网络文件系统等;目标挂载点
表示挂载后的设备在文件系统中的挂载点。
mount命令常用参数及功能
1、-t 文件系统类型
该参数用于指定要挂载的文件系统类型,如:
mount -t ext4 /dev/sda1 /mnt
上述命令将ext4文件系统挂载到/mnt目录。
2、-o 挂载选项
挂载选项用于指定挂载时的特殊选项,以下是一些常用的挂载选项:
- ro:只读挂载,即只能读取文件系统中的内容,不能修改。
- rw:读写挂载,即可以读取和修改文件系统中的内容。
- bind:将一个目录绑定到另一个目录,实现文件系统级别的共享。
- loop:将一个文件作为设备挂载。
以下命令将/dev/sda1以只读方式挂载到/mnt目录:
mount -t ext4 -o ro /dev/sda1 /mnt
3、-a
该参数用于自动挂载所有未挂载的文件系统,非常方便。
4、-l
列出所有已挂载的文件系统。
5、-u
卸载指定文件系统。
mount命令在实际操作中的应用
1、挂载虚拟机硬盘
在KVM虚拟机中,我们可以使用mount命令挂载虚拟机的硬盘,以便对硬盘中的文件进行访问,以下是一个示例:
(1)查看虚拟机的硬盘信息:
fdisk -l
(2)使用mount命令挂载虚拟机的硬盘:
mount -t ext4 /dev/vda1 /mnt
/dev/vda1为虚拟机的硬盘设备,/mnt为挂载点。
2、挂载网络文件系统
在KVM虚拟机中,我们还可以使用mount命令挂载网络文件系统,如NFS、SMB等,以下是一个示例:
(1)在主机上配置NFS服务器。
(2)在虚拟机中挂载NFS服务器:
mount -t nfs 192.168.1.100:/export /mnt
192.168.1.100为NFS服务器的IP地址,/export为共享目录,/mnt为挂载点。
3、挂载光盘镜像
在KVM虚拟机中,我们可以使用mount命令挂载光盘镜像,以便安装软件或访问光盘中的内容,以下是一个示例:
(1)创建光盘镜像文件:
dd if=/dev/cdrom of=/path/to/image.iso bs=4M
(2)挂载光盘镜像:
mount -o loop /path/to/image.iso /mnt
/path/to/image.iso为光盘镜像文件,/mnt为挂载点。
本文详细介绍了KVM虚拟机命令mount的用法、参数及其在实际操作中的应用,掌握mount命令,可以帮助我们在KVM虚拟机中更好地管理文件系统,提高工作效率,在实际操作中,请根据具体情况选择合适的挂载参数,以确保文件系统的稳定性和安全性。
本文链接:https://zhitaoyun.cn/651118.html
发表评论